Orphan Number: 401

Orphan: Mary Ann BOULTON
Mother: BOULTON, Esther
Father: ,
Mother's ship: Hydery
Father's ship:
Age when admitted: 3yrs
Date admitted: 27 Feb 1836
Date discharged: 22 Sep 1842
Institutions(s): Queens Orphan School
Discharged to: mother
Remarks: father unknown
References:SWD7, 28, CSO5/86/1885, CSO5/191/4635

Catherine Hamilton wrote:

Mary Ann Boulton married William Selwyn in 1850. Their daughter Esther married Charles Nicholls, the son of a miller who arrived in Launceston 1855 to run the mill on the Supply River, West Tamar. Mary Ann and William had another daughter, Susannah, who became a very well known nurse - Nurse Galley.
